Word | Premolar |
a tooth having two cusps or points; located between the incisors and the molars / Situated in front of the molar teeth. / a tooth situated between the canine and the molar teeth. An adult human normally has eight, two in each jaw on each side., | |
Usage | ⇒ The normal permanent dentition comprises four incisors, two canines, four premolars , and six molars in each jaw. |
